Mylan Pharmaceuticals is a global pharmaceutical company that specializes in the production and distribution of generic and specialty pharmaceuticals. The company is committed to providing accessible and affordable medications to people all over the world. Mylan has established itself as a leading player in the global pharmaceutical industry through its commitment to quality, safety, and innovation. Uses Mylan produces a wide range of medications that are used to treat a variety of medical conditions. Some of the most commonly prescribed medications produced by Mylan include: - Alprazolam is used to treat anxiety and panic disorders. - Amlodipine is used to treat high blood pressure and angina. - Atorvastatin is used to reduce the risk of heart attack and stroke in people with high cholesterol. - Azithromycin is used to treat bacterial infections. - Haloperidol is used to treat certain mental disorders. - Levothyroxine is used to treat an underactive thyroid. - Risperidone is used to treat schizophrenia and bipolar disorder. - Sumatriptan is used to treat migraine headaches. Generic Mylan is well-known for producing generic medications. Generic medications are less expensive than brand-name medications, but they contain the same active ingredient and are as safe and effective. Generic medications are FDA-approved and have undergone rigorous testing to ensure that they are of the same quality and potency as their brand-name counterparts.
